Dr. Anthony Chi is a hematology and pathology specialist with 18 years of medical experience. He earned his medical degree from the Perelman School of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ania, where he developed expertise in blood disorders and laboratory medicine. His dual specialization allows him to diagnose and treat blood-related conditions while also analyzing tissue samples and laboratory specimens to guide patient care.
Dr. Chi practices at Massachusetts General Hospital and sees patients at locations in McLean, Virginia and Boston, Massachusetts. He specializes in treating conditions such as lymph node inflammation, abnormal white blood cell counts, and low white blood cell levels. His procedural expertise includes comprehensive pathology testing, detailed analysis of surgical tissue samples, and specialized kidney transplant biopsies that help ensure successful organ transplantation outcomes.
